Address NK6EX3ZvaAEy6EQ4VFqZ4CzZQ8Ju3fX7gq

Total received 4998.70922389 NMC
Total sent 4998.70922389 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
April 5, 2022, 3:32 p.m. edabd6948… 606257 4998.70922389 NMC 0.00000000 NMC
April 5, 2022, 2:43 p.m. 82461b7a0… 606249 4998.70922389 NMC 4998.70922389 NMC